Project Broken Wheel Volunteer Session 1 @ Twin River Casino
Dec 6 @ 5:00 pm – 7:30 pm
Project Broken Wheel Volunteer Session 1 @ Twin River Casino | Lincoln | Rhode Island | United States

A holiday charity event for Project Broken Wheel, led by Twin River Casino employees. Volunteers for Project Broken Wheel Workshops are needed for two days to help refurbish bikes to be given to children in need throughout Rhode Island. Twin River Casino employees and volunteers refurbish donated bicycles on-site and prepare them to be delivered to local community organizations. The donated bikes get seat replacements, tires repaired, chains fixed, reflectors placed on tires and the front and back of the bike, touch up paint and a holiday bow.

Over the last 8 years, the program has donated 964 bicycles to local children’s organizations, including Manville Family Literacy Center, Lincoln Adopt-A-Family, Boys & Girls Club, YMCA, Institute for the Study & Practice of Non-Violence, Martin Luther King Family Center, Children & Family Services, Saint Lucy Heart, Salve Regina University Scholarship Program & local underprivileged families in the area. This year, organizers hope to donate an additional 50 bicycles to children during the holiday season.

Eat Drink RI Sommelier Punchdown @ Sprout Coworking Providence
Apr 24 @ 6:00 pm

The eighth annual Eat Drink RI Festival will kick off on April 24 with Rhode Island’s second Sommelier Punchdown event at the new Sprout Coworking space in Providence. Guests will have the chance to taste a variety of wines as a group of the state’s best Certified Sommeliers compete in a wine theory quiz, a blind wine tasting, and a collaboration with a local chef.

Eat Drink RI Rhody Women’s Feast @ Revival Foodworks & Brewery
Apr 25 @ 6:00 pm

The Eat Drink RI Festival will debut a new event, The Rhody Women’s Feast, on April 25 at the new Sprout Coworking space in Providence. A handful of top Rhode Island female chefs will prepare a multi-course dining experience for guests benefiting the Women’s Fund of Rhode Island. Spirits will be provided by women-owned distilleries Boston Harbor Distillery and Pomp & Whimsy Gin Liqueur. The Eat Drink RI Festival is an annual showcase of the culinary world in Rhode Island, offering four days of culinary and beverage events.
